AETURNUM II: GENESIS
Aeturnum II: Genesis is a special full-day D&D event, introducing the world and setting of our upcoming second campaign! Genesis is a standalone experience, allowing you to play a Level 10 Adrestian champion tasked with leading the ill-fated expedition to slay Tisis' vampiric queen. Your death is certain, but your actions on that fated battlefield will echo throughout the world of Campaign II, shaping the next generation of heroes who rise to fill the ranks of the Wayfarers Guild.
‘The Herald is coming. Fear the night.’
This special has been designed to serve as an introduction to Aeturnum II for both new and returning players. For the best possible experience, we recommend ensuring that you have played in the world of Aeturnum before, or are familiar with the tone and events of the previous Campaign. TABLETOP INDUSTRY NETWORK
Do you know about our friends, the UK Tabletop Industry Network? They're a group of roleplaying and board game designers, artists and writers from all over the country, and many of their games are available for purchase at the Arcanist's Tavern. If you're working on a game of your own, or merely want to, perhaps they're people you'd want to speak to. If you visit the Tavern on the first Thursday of any month after 7.00pm, they say you might even meet their London contingent in person when they gather at our own bar to network and socialise.
